1. Why Choose Elementor and WooCommerce?
Before we get into the nitty-gritty, let’s talk about why Elementor and WooCommerce are a match made in heaven for building a membership site. Elementor is a powerful page builder that allows you to design stunning, responsive pages without touching a single line of code. WooCommerce, on the other hand, is a robust e-commerce plugin that handles everything from payments to product management. Together, they create a seamless experience for both you and your members. 🌟
2. Setting Up Your WordPress Site 🖥️
First things first, you need to have a WordPress site up and running. If you haven’t set one up yet, it’s a straightforward process:
– Choose a hosting provider and register a domain name.
– Install WordPress through your hosting dashboard.
– Pick a theme that complements your brand (Elementor works well with most themes).
Once your WordPress site is live, you’re ready to start building your membership site.
3. Installing and Configuring Elementor
With WordPress ready, it’s time to install Elementor:
– Go to the WordPress dashboard and navigate to Plugins > Add New.
– Search for “Elementor” and click Install Now, then Activate.
– Once activated, you’ll find Elementor in your WordPress sidebar.
Elementor offers a free version, but for more advanced features, consider upgrading to Elementor Pro.
4. Integrating WooCommerce for Memberships
WooCommerce will handle the e-commerce side of your membership site. Here’s how to get started:
– From the WordPress dashboard, go to Plugins > Add New.
– Search for “WooCommerce” and click Install Now, then Activate.
– Follow the WooCommerce setup wizard to configure your store settings.
Now, you’ll need a membership plugin. We recommend using WooCommerce Memberships, an extension that integrates seamlessly with WooCommerce. Install and configure this plugin to set up membership plans, payment gateways, and access controls.
5. Creating and Designing Membership Pages
Now, for the fun part—designing your membership pages with Elementor! 🎨
– Create a new page in WordPress and click “Edit with Elementor.”
– Use Elementor’s drag-and-drop interface to add elements like headers, text, images, and call-to-action buttons.
– Incorporate WooCommerce shortcodes to display membership products and pricing tables.
– Customize the design to reflect your brand’s identity.
With Elementor’s vast library of templates and widgets, the possibilities are endless. Don’t forget to optimize for mobile users!

FAQs 🤔
Q1: Do I need coding skills to build a membership site with Elementor and WooCommerce?
A1: Nope! Both Elementor and WooCommerce are designed for users without coding skills. Their intuitive interfaces make the process straightforward.
Q2: Is Elementor Pro necessary for building a membership site?
A2: While you can start with the free version of Elementor, Elementor Pro offers advanced features that can enhance your site’s functionality and design.
Q3: Can I offer different membership levels with WooCommerce?
A3: Absolutely! WooCommerce Memberships allows you to create multiple membership tiers, each with its own pricing and access levels.
